Author: nsantos
Date: Fri Feb 17 20:54:48 2012
New Revision: 1245757
URL: http://svn.apache.org/viewvc?rev=1245757&view=rev
Log:
more fixes for compilation under fedora 18, new gcc
Modified:
qpid/trunk/qpid/cpp/src/qmf/Hash.h
qpid/trunk/qpid/cpp/src/qpid/sys/Shlib.h
qpid/trunk/qpid/cpp/src/qpid/sys/posix/SystemInfo.cpp
Modified: qpid/trunk/qpid/cpp/src/qmf/Hash.h
URL:
http://svn.apache.org/viewvc/qpid/trunk/qpid/cpp/src/qmf/Hash.h?rev=1245757&r1=1245756&r2=1245757&view=diff
==============================================================================
--- qpid/trunk/qpid/cpp/src/qmf/Hash.h (original)
+++ qpid/trunk/qpid/cpp/src/qmf/Hash.h Fri Feb 17 20:54:48 2012
@@ -29,7 +29,7 @@ namespace qmf {
class Hash {
public:
Hash();
- qpid::types::Uuid asUuid() const { return qpid::types::Uuid((unsigned
char*) data); }
+ qpid::types::Uuid asUuid() const { return qpid::types::Uuid((const
unsigned char*) data); }
void update(const char* s, uint32_t len);
void update(uint8_t v) { update((char*) &v, sizeof(v)); }
void update(uint32_t v) { update((char*) &v, sizeof(v)); }
Modified: qpid/trunk/qpid/cpp/src/qpid/sys/Shlib.h
URL:
http://svn.apache.org/viewvc/qpid/trunk/qpid/cpp/src/qpid/sys/Shlib.h?rev=1245757&r1=1245756&r2=1245757&view=diff
==============================================================================
--- qpid/trunk/qpid/cpp/src/qpid/sys/Shlib.h (original)
+++ qpid/trunk/qpid/cpp/src/qpid/sys/Shlib.h Fri Feb 17 20:54:48 2012
@@ -23,6 +23,7 @@
*/
#include "qpid/CommonImportExport.h"
+#include "qpid/sys/IntegerTypes.h"
#include <boost/noncopyable.hpp>
#include <iostream>
Modified: qpid/trunk/qpid/cpp/src/qpid/sys/posix/SystemInfo.cpp
URL:
http://svn.apache.org/viewvc/qpid/trunk/qpid/cpp/src/qpid/sys/posix/SystemInfo.cpp?rev=1245757&r1=1245756&r2=1245757&view=diff
==============================================================================
--- qpid/trunk/qpid/cpp/src/qpid/sys/posix/SystemInfo.cpp (original)
+++ qpid/trunk/qpid/cpp/src/qpid/sys/posix/SystemInfo.cpp Fri Feb 17 20:54:48
2012
@@ -28,6 +28,7 @@
#include <sys/socket.h> // For FreeBSD
#include <netinet/in.h> // For FreeBSD
#include <ifaddrs.h>
+#include <unistd.h>
#include <iostream>
#include <fstream>
#include <sstream>
---------------------------------------------------------------------
Apache Qpid - AMQP Messaging Implementation
Project: http://qpid.apache.org
Use/Interact: mailto:[email protected]